Children’s Christmas pudding making hits the Maynard

Published: Fri Oct 31 2008


Peak District hotel and restaurant The Maynard is opening its doors to Grindleford Primary School again at 9.00am on Friday 7 November, for the children to make their own Christmas puddings which will then go on sale in the local community to raise money for the school.

The Maynard is once again hosting the event, providing all ingredients free of charge, and giving the children a gourmet ‘school dinner’ in the ballroom at lunch time.

At 9.00am, around 30 pupils will descend on The Maynard to prepare their Christmas puddings under the watchful eye of The Maynard’s chefs, teachers, and The Maynard’s director Paul Downing, who first had the idea of inviting the children last year – which was so successful that the event is now developing into an annual date in the diary.

At lunch time the children will be joined by around 20 infants, aged up to 6 years old, who will then get their chance to make Christmas puddings in the afternoon.
